Slow-cooked duck leg confit from Southwest France, preserved in its fat. A regional classic often served with potatoes or beans.
Toulouse sausage with white beans, duck or pork in a rich stew. This iconic Occitan dish is strongly tied to the Haute-Garonne area.
A garlicky emulsion of salt cod and olive oil or milk, eaten with bread or potatoes. Traditional in nearby Toulouse and wider Occitan cuisine.

The ticket office is open Mon - Sun: 07:15 - 18:00. Information desks are information services are available at the SNCF ticket office. Located in Hall 1 on Level 2 near Track 1.
Luggage storage is automatic lockers are located in Hall 1 on level 2 close to Track 24.

The ticket office is open Mon - Sun: 08:00 - 20:00. Information desks are located on the ground level near the Seine entrance and on the underground level near the RER stairs and escalator.
Luggage storage is automatic lockers are located across from Platforms 1 and 2 and are open daily from 06:00 to 22:00. .

The ticket office is open Mon - Sun: 04:45 - 01:30. Information desks are located in Hall 1.
Luggage storage is luggage lockers are available daily from 06:15 to 22:00. They are located on the first level in Hall 3 on the Rue de Bercy side of the station.
